Glycosylation in Microalgal Host Cells

Microalgae have generated increasing interest as microbial cell factories to produce therapeutics proteins. This is because they can grow on very cheap media and their GRAS (generally regarded as safe) status means they are a fantastic option for the production of therapeutics that can be administered orally. Engineering Virus-Like Particles (VLPS) for the Next-Generation Vaccines

Virus-like particles (VLPs) are molecules that mimic viruses and will trigger immune response when introduced into body. As they do not contain any viral genetic material, they are not infectious. Read more

Engineering Protein Nanocompartments for Biotechnological Applications

Protein nanocompartments have board applications as catalytic nanoreactors and as carriers for therapeutics delivery. They are self-assembled protein-based supramolecules that have spherical and hollow architectures. Read more
